Output 51662e96d7b300346b68215f6de81573721bf216c5f785dd200d86a366c185a4:0

value
3202748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a1c69b707eb3efce3c4318b92eb84fc545f7d2 OP_EQUAL
address
3JhqQc1nvrJAUu8nNy6fEjbgRLLGDYm5c7
transaction
51662e96d7b300346b68215f6de81573721bf216c5f785dd200d86a366c185a4
spent
true